Application 1: 
Anchorage of walls and columns of garages and carports serving not more than one dwelling unit, for buildings to which Part 9 applies [see Sentence 1.3.3.3.(1) of Division A for application of Part 9].

Intent
Intent 1: 
To limit the probability of inadequately anchored walls or columns, which could lead to the displacement by wind suction forces, which could lead to the structural failure of garages or carports, which could lead to harm to persons.
